IP查询
查询
你查询的IP:[117.22.159.172] 地理位置:中国–陕西–西安
最新查询
222.16.232.125
219.242.43.192
122.102.75.224
119.112.82.229
123.101.3.224
117.48.129.186
220.252.143.59
118.120.10.190
220.160.202.21
117.22.159.172
202.136.208.105
202.164.25.143
123.144.193.65
119.235.128.249
203.223.192.220
121.52.160.24
118.248.10.129
202.127.160.243
210.5.110.30
124.242.114.124
210.76.23.190
123.49.128.0
203.130.32.243
203.100.192.233
117.75.57.209
123.137.162.21
123.253.58.217
203.18.50.198
203.110.160.192
210.185.192.2
58.87.64.145